The dynamic gas diluter domain sits at the intersection of precision instrumentation, regulatory compliance, and cross-sector process control, serving as a foundational capability wherever accurate low- and high-concentration gas mixtures are required. Calibrating analytical instruments, validating emissions monitoring systems, controlling industrial processes, and enabling laboratory research all depend on reliable dilution systems that combine metrology-grade control with operational resilience. As a result, buyers and engineers prioritize traceability, repeatability, and ease of integration when evaluating diluter solutions.

Underlying this demand is a steady evolution in the technological underpinnings of diluters. Innovations in micro flow control, electronic pressure regulation, and embedded automation have elevated expectations for response times, drift characteristics, and remote operability. At the same time, growing regulatory scrutiny and the expansion of monitoring networks have broadened the set of organizations that require calibration-grade gas generation-from traditional metrology labs to field-deployed monitoring stations and process control nodes. Consequently, suppliers are challenged to balance precision engineering with scalable service models while maintaining rigorous documentation to satisfy compliance audits and customer quality assurance protocols.

Transformative shifts reshaping the dynamic gas diluter landscape driven by regulatory tightening, automation advances, and cross-industry demand convergence

A set of transformative shifts is reconfiguring requirements across product design, service delivery, and channel strategies for dynamic gas diluter providers. Regulatory tightening on emissions and workplace safety has increased the density and geographic spread of monitoring. This drives demand not only for laboratory-grade calibration capabilities but also for field-ready dilution systems that can operate reliably under varied environmental conditions and provide secure, auditable data. In parallel, end users are asking for more integrated solutions where dilution hardware, flow control electronics, and cloud-enabled diagnostics are bundled to reduce integration risk and accelerate deployment.

Technological advances are equally influential. The maturation of mass flow control technologies and high-resolution electronic pressure controllers has enabled smaller form factors and finer control over dilution ratios, enabling ultra-low concentration generation without extensive manual intervention. Automation is progressing as well; fully automatic systems with remote monitoring and programmable interfaces reduce operator dependency and support distributed calibration networks. These shifts are catalyzing new commercial models, including subscription-based service offerings and performance guarantees tied to calibration accuracy and uptime, prompting incumbents to rethink value propositions and aftermarket service strategies.

Finally, cross-industry convergence is changing buyer expectations. Segments such as semiconductor fabrication and biopharmaceutical manufacturing demand stricter contamination control and traceability, borrowing best practices from environmental monitoring and analytical laboratories. As a result, suppliers that can demonstrate interoperable hardware, robust data lineage, and service infrastructures that span installation, calibration, and preventive maintenance stand to gain stronger customer loyalty. Strategic investments in digital enablement, lifecycle services, and industry-specific compliance workflows are emerging as key differentiators in this evolving competitive landscape.

Cumulative effects of United States tariff actions in 2025 on supply chains, pricing dynamics, and strategic sourcing for dynamic gas diluter stakeholders

United States tariff actions implemented in 2025 have introduced a pronounced set of operational and strategic considerations for suppliers, integrators, and end users of dynamic gas diluters. Tariffs on specific components and assembled instruments have increased landed costs for manufacturers that rely on imported sensors, precision valves, and electronic control modules. For many suppliers this has meant reassessing supplier networks and evaluating whether to absorb cost changes, pass them through to customers, or seek alternative component sources that mitigate exposure to tariffed goods.

The ripple effects extend beyond direct input cost. Supply chain reconfiguration to avoid tariffed routes can lengthen lead times and complicate inventory planning, especially for products that require tight component matching to achieve calibration-grade performance. To manage these risks, manufacturers are accelerating qualification of secondary suppliers, increasing inventory buffers for critical components, and investing in design flexibility that can accommodate multiple sourcing options without compromising metrological integrity. These actions are improving resilience but also raise working capital requirements and may slow time-to-market for new product variants.

Strategically, tariffs have prompted a renewed focus on nearshoring and onshore assembly for higher-value subsystems where the labor and compliance advantages justify the shift. Companies with aftermarket service networks and local calibration capabilities are better positioned to offset tariff-driven cost increases by emphasizing total cost of ownership, faster service turnaround, and bundled offerings. In parallel, procurement teams at end user organizations are placing greater emphasis on contractual terms that address price volatility, lead-time penalties, and supplier continuity to protect operational reliability. Collectively, these responses are shaping a landscape where agility in sourcing and a clear articulation of value beyond unit price determine competitive advantage.

Segment-level insights revealing how application, end user industry, technology, automation, and dilution range drive differentiated product requirements and buy criteria

Understanding the market through multiple segmentation lenses clarifies how product attributes and go-to-market strategies must be tailored to distinct buyer needs. Based on application, the market spans calibration gas generation, emissions monitoring, environmental testing, industrial process control, and laboratory research; within calibration gas generation there are fixed calibration applications and portable calibration applications; emissions monitoring differentiates between stack emissions monitoring and vehicle emissions testing; environmental testing includes ambient air monitoring and indoor air quality; industrial process control is further specialized across chemical processing and petrochemical refining; and laboratory research encompasses academic research and analytical instrumentation. This spectrum demands that suppliers balance portability and ruggedization for field work with the traceability and low-drift characteristics required in laboratory environments.

From an end user industry perspective, markets include automotive, environmental agencies, food and beverage, petrochemical, pharmaceutical, and semiconductor; environmental agencies bifurcate into government monitoring and private consulting; petrochemical considerations divide across ethylene production and refining; and pharmaceutical applications separate into biopharmaceutical manufacturing and drug research. Each industry brings specific regulatory regimes, sampling protocols, and service expectations, meaning that a one-size-fits-all product rarely meets the nuanced demands of both high-throughput manufacturing environments and field regulatory monitoring operations.

Technology segmentation further separates offerings into mass flow controllers and pressure controllers, where mass flow controllers subdivide into micro flow controllers and smart flow controllers, and pressure controllers focus on electronic pressure control. The choice of technology influences dynamic response, stability at ultra-low flow rates, and integration options with digital control systems. Automation level matters as well, with fully automatic systems that support integrated process control and remote monitoring capability contrasted with manual and semi automatic options where operator-assisted or programmable interfaces remain common. Finally, dilution range-high range above specified thresholds, mid range covering intermediate concentrations, and low range below defined thresholds including ultra-low ranges-guides engineering priorities for sensor selection, leak management, and calibration procedures. When combined, these segmentation layers reveal where incremental product innovation, tailored service packages, and targeted channel strategies will yield the most commercially relevant differentiation.

Regional dynamics and competitive moats across Americas, Europe, Middle East & Africa, and Asia-Pacific that influence adoption, service models, and innovation pathways

Regional dynamics exert a strong influence on product design, certification requirements, service expectations, and go-to-market models within the dynamic gas diluter space. In the Americas, demand centers emphasize rapid deployment of field monitoring solutions, integration with established legacy networks, and stringent documentation for workplace safety and emissions compliance; suppliers operating here often invest in regional service hubs to shorten calibration cycles and provide timely technical support. In Europe, Middle East & Africa, regulatory frameworks and multilateral environmental directives drive adoption of interoperable systems and harmonized reporting; this region often requires suppliers to demonstrate compliance with a broad set of standards and to provide multi-language support and regional calibration traceability across diverse operating environments.

Asia-Pacific is characterized by a heterogeneous mix of advanced industrial clusters and rapidly growing monitoring networks, resulting in heightened demand for scalable, cost-effective solutions that can be adapted to both high-volume manufacturing sites and decentralized monitoring infrastructures. Within this region, local content requirements and rising domestic manufacturing capabilities influence sourcing strategies and partnerships, while service models must be adapted to varying levels of local technical expertise. Across all regions, aftermarket services, including calibration, preventive maintenance, and remote diagnostics, are increasingly important differentiators, with buyers favoring suppliers that can guarantee continuity of measurement quality through comprehensive lifecycle support.

As a consequence, successful regional strategies combine technical excellence with tailored commercial frameworks. Suppliers that align certification portfolios, training offerings, and spare parts distribution with regional regulatory regimes and end user expectations reduce friction in procurement and accelerate value realization for customers. Building regional intelligence into product roadmaps and service investments becomes a key enabler of sustained market relevance.

Corporate strategies and competitive positioning insights focused on product innovation, channel partnerships, aftermarket services, and technology differentiation for suppliers

Competitive dynamics among established players and emerging specialists are shaping how value is delivered across the dynamic gas diluter ecosystem. Leading suppliers are differentiating through integrated offerings that combine precision hardware, smart flow control electronics, and software-enabled diagnostics to lower the customer burden of system integration. Partnerships with instrumentation manufacturers, OEMs, and channel distributors remain a common strategy to expand reach into segment-specific end markets while mitigating the capital intensity of direct field service expansion.

Companies focusing on modular designs and open communication protocols are winning preference among customers who require plug-and-play compatibility with existing data acquisition systems. Aftermarket service capabilities-remote diagnostics, local calibration stations, and rapid spare parts logistics-are increasingly decisive in renewal decisions, pushing suppliers to invest in service engineering and training programs. In addition, firms that develop strong domain expertise in high-compliance industries such as pharmaceuticals and semiconductor manufacturing are able to command higher levels of trust by demonstrating adherence to strict validation processes and by providing custom documentation and qualification support.

Innovation strategies now frequently emphasize software-enabled differentiation: predictive maintenance algorithms, user-friendly configuration tools, and secure cloud connectivity for traceable calibration records. At the same time, smaller specialized firms are carving niches by offering ultra-low range dilution capabilities, portable turnkey systems for field calibration, or highly automated solutions for continuous emissions monitoring. The net effect is a fragmented landscape where scale, vertical specialization, and service excellence determine competitive advantage.
